Low cost: Bubble wrap & multi-layered foil NettetWeatherstripping is the process of sealing doors, windows, automobiles, etc. from outside elements. Weatherstripping is often implemented to prevent rain and water to enter the interior of a building or vehicle. Often, this is accomplished by rerouting the water. A second goal of weatherstripping is energy conservation – keeping interior air in.

Alternatively, you can pack mineral … order thanksgiving dinner from cracker barrelNettetFibreglass insulation is one of the most popular types of insulation for sheds. It is made up of tiny glass fibres, and it comes in batts or rolls that are easy to install between the framing of the shed walls, ceiling, and floor.
